Ozone depletion:

Ozone serves as a protective layer which prevents the harmful ultraviolet rays. The ozone layer is situated in the upper atmosphere. The hazardous substances especially like chlorine reacts with the oxygen atoms in ozone that results in the depletion of the ozone layer.
